Roman Cielewicz (13 January 1930 – 21 January 1996) was a graphic designer and photographer from Poland (naturalized French). He migrated to France in 1963 and became a French citizen in 1971. He was the artistic inventor of Opus International (1967-1969) and served as the art director of Vogue, Elle, and Mafia – advertising firm.
